1 Pg. 35

2  Largest planet (5 th from Sun)  11 times larger than Earth (makes up 70 % of planetary matter)  Has a banded appearance due to atmosphere  Has 4 major satellites and at least 12 minor ones  Composed of light weight elements  Atmosphere- H and He in both gas and liquid form; has liquid metallic H; electric currents  Earth-sized core of heavier elements that have sunk.

3  Spins fast (1 rotation= 10 hrs)  Shape is distorted because of fast spin  Has “Great Red Spot” which is a atmospheric storm that has been rotating around Jupiter for more than 300 years  Alternating cloud types  Belts- low, warm, dark-colored clouds that sink  Zones- high, cool, light-colored clouds that rise

4  4 largest moons called satellites:  Io  Europa  Ganymede  Callisto  Composed of ice and rock mixtures  Jupiter’s ring is 6400 km wide

5  Second largest planet  Atmosphere- rotates rapidly and has belts and zones; H and He and also ammonia ice  Most likely fluid throughout with small solid core

6  Rings are composed of rock and ice (microscopic to size of houses)  7 major rings that are each made up of ringlets  18 known satellites  Titan (giant)  7 intermediate moons  10 small moons

7  Discovered accidently  Has blue, velvety appearance  Atmosphere- methane gas (reflects blue light), H and He; few clouds  Completely fluid except small core  Axis is almost horizontal (Uranus was knocked sideways)  Each pole spends 42 years in darkness and 42 years in sunlight

8  18 known moons and rings  Recently 3 more possible moons have been discovered  Rings are very dark, almost black  Were discovered when a star was covered by them

9  Few details can be observed from Earth because of its distance away  Atmosphere- bluish color because of methane; has distinctive clouds  Had a persistent storm called the Great Dark Spot that disappeared in 1994

10  Has eight moons (largest is Triton)  Triton orbits backwards  Has 6 rings that are comprised of dust particles
